Sala Beach House introduces its first yoga retreat by the sea

I’m so excited to invite you to the Sala Beach House, owned by Craig Rutherfoord. This incredible wellness retreat has breathtaking views of the Indian Ocean and direct access to the Thompsons Bay Blue Flag beach. It’s the perfect place to relax and rejuvenate. Our amazing yoga teacher and nature lover, Christie Holt, will be guiding us through this journey, blending the power of yoga with the beauty of nature.
